Chris Bell gave a couple of examples of Orlanth priestesses in early RQ sources, namely the rules and CoP. There were a couple of other examples of Orlanth worshipping women. Have a gawk in the RQII version of "Apple Lane" and you'll find a high percentage of the women in there are Orlanth initiates. One that sticks in my mind was that Kareena, originally an Orlanth Priestess, became a shaman in the RQIII edition. Maybe his Divine (capitalisation in deference to Alex) Gregness *genuflects* was trying to tell us that female Orlanth priests were a bit thinner on the ground than had been previously implied?

Jane also makes the comment that women can't join the Adventurous version, which probably explains why the changes were made, but I'm buggered if I saw statement to that effect in the "River of Cradles" version of Orlanth.
